引言
海纳蓝IC是一款在电子设计领域备受关注的产品。它以其高性能、低功耗和丰富的功能特点,成为了许多工程师的选择。本文将带领读者从入门到精通,深入了解海纳蓝IC,并提供五大关键技巧,帮助读者更好地掌握这款芯片。
一、海纳蓝IC简介
1.1 产品概述
海纳蓝IC是一款基于ARM Cortex-M系列内核的微控制器,具有高性能、低功耗、高集成度等特点。它广泛应用于工业控制、智能家居、物联网等领域。
1.2 核心特点
- 高性能:采用高性能ARM Cortex-M内核,运行速度快,处理能力强。
- 低功耗:支持多种低功耗模式,满足不同应用场景的需求。
- 高集成度:集成多种外设,如ADC、DAC、UART、SPI等,简化系统设计。
- 丰富的功能:支持多种通信接口,如I2C、SPI、UART等,满足不同应用需求。
二、海纳蓝IC入门技巧
2.1 熟悉开发环境
- 集成开发环境(IDE):选择合适的IDE,如Keil、IAR等,进行代码编写和调试。
- 开发板:购买海纳蓝IC的开发板,熟悉开发板的结构和功能。
2.2 硬件电路设计
- 电源设计:根据海纳蓝IC的电源要求,设计合适的电源电路。
- 外围电路设计:根据应用需求,设计外围电路,如ADC、DAC、UART等。
2.3 软件编程
- C语言编程:学习C语言编程,掌握海纳蓝IC的编程方法。
- 固件库使用:熟悉海纳蓝IC的固件库,掌握常用外设的使用方法。
三、海纳蓝IC进阶技巧
3.1 高效调试
- 使用调试器:熟练使用调试器,如J-Link、ST-Link等,进行代码调试。
- 代码优化:优化代码,提高程序运行效率。
3.2 系统优化
- 电源管理:根据应用需求,优化电源管理策略,降低功耗。
- 性能优化:针对关键算法进行优化,提高系统性能。
3.3 代码维护
- 模块化设计:采用模块化设计,提高代码可读性和可维护性。
- 版本控制:使用版本控制系统,如Git,进行代码管理。
四、海纳蓝IC五大关键技巧
4.1 熟练掌握开发工具
- IDE:熟练使用IDE,提高编程效率。
- 调试器:熟练使用调试器,快速定位问题。
4.2 精通硬件电路设计
- 电源设计:掌握电源设计技巧,确保系统稳定运行。
- 外围电路设计:熟悉常用外设的电路设计,提高电路可靠性。
4.3 深入了解固件库
- 外设驱动:熟悉常用外设的驱动程序,提高系统功能。
- 固件库扩展:根据需求,扩展固件库功能。
4.4 代码优化与维护
- 代码风格:遵循良好的代码风格,提高代码可读性。
- 代码重构:定期对代码进行重构,提高代码质量。
4.5 系统集成与优化
- 系统集成:熟悉系统集成流程,提高系统稳定性。
- 性能优化:针对关键性能指标进行优化,提高系统性能。
五、总结
通过本文的介绍,相信读者对海纳蓝IC有了更深入的了解。掌握这五大关键技巧,有助于读者更好地掌握海纳蓝IC,将其应用于实际项目中。在今后的学习和工作中,不断积累经验,提高自己的技能水平,相信你将成为一名优秀的电子工程师。